I’ll admit - despite my geek status, I didn’t know exactly what a Von Neumann machine was/is. I extrapolated/inferred from the context that it had something to do with a machine for making things. Well, I was sort of right; a von Neumann machine is also known as a self-replicating machine. According to your friend and mine, Wikipedia, a self-replicating machine is:

… an artificial construct that is capable of autonomously manufacturing a copy of itself using simpler components or raw materials taken from its environment. The concept of self-replicating machines has been most notably advanced and examined by, Homer Jacobsen, Edward F. Moore, Freeman Dyson, John von Neumann and in more recent times by K. Eric Drexler.
